Trim Levels
You can choose from four trim levels for the latest Blazer. The base model is the 2LT, which has an MSRP of $35,400. It features body-color door handles, mirror caps, and antenna to give it a unified look, and the Blazer signature grille will leave an impression. Next in the lineup is the 3LT, and it starts at $39,300. With this trim, you get heated power auto-dimming side mirrors with turn signal indicators and roof-mounted side rails in black to help you carry more gear.
Moving up to the third tier, you'll find the RS trim. This option has a starting MSRP of $42,800 and comes with stylish design elements such as 20-inch gray aluminum wheels and an RS signature grille that makes it stand out in the crowd. At the top of the Blazer lineup is the elegant Premier trim, which starts at $44,195. With the Premier trim, you can expect upgrades like silver roof-mounted side rails, a chrome-trimmed horizontal grille, and chrome exterior accents.
Engine and Performance
Two engine options are available for the 2025 Chevy Blazer. The standard block is a 2.0-liter turbo four-cylinder that won't disappoint. It generates up to 228 horsepower and 258 lb-ft of torque, which is more than enough to get you around Plano or across Texas with ease. With this engine, you'll get up to 22 mpg in the city and an impressive 29 mpg on the highway. An optional 3.6-liter V-6 engine is also available if you need a little more power under the hood. This engine can deliver 308 horsepower and 270 lb-ft of torque.
No matter which engine you have, it pairs with a nine-speed automatic transmission and has auto start-stop technology for improved efficiency. Opt for the advanced twin-clutch all-wheel-drive system for optimized traction on any road surface.
Safety and Technology Features
When you choose the new Chevy Blazer, you'll get high-tech features that keep you connected and safe no matter where the road takes you. A remote start system lets you start the Blazer from a distance, making it easy to warm or cool the vehicle before you're ready to go. It also has six USB ports where you can plug in your devices to connect them to the Blazer and keep them charged up. A Wi-Fi hot spot lets you connect as many as seven devices, allowing you and your passengers to get online anytime.
For safety, you'll have smart features like adaptive cruise control, forward collision alert, emergency braking, and lane-keeping assist with lane departure alert to help you navigate the streets of Plano. These features offer audio and visual cues that keep you aware of what's happening around you as you drive.

What To Look for on a Test Drive
Before you decide to purchase any new vehicle, it's always a good idea to get behind the wheel and take it for a test-drive. While you're cruising the Blazer around Plano on your test-drive, you'll want to be aware of several things that can help you decide if it's the right SUV for you. Most importantly, consider how it feels to sit in the driver's seat. Can you adjust the seat to a comfortable position? Are the mirrors at the right angle so you can see around you easily? Is everything within reach, such as the infotainment screen?
As you drive, think about how the engine sounds and feels. Does the Blazer accelerate to your standards? Is the braking working well so you stop when expected? Do you feel the gear changes are smooth? Answering these questions as you drive will help you make an informed decision before you buy.
